Table of Contents
Replit, a popular online coding platform, has integrated powerful AI-powered features called Power-Ups to enhance the coding experience. These tools aim to automate repetitive tasks and improve testing efficiency, making coding more accessible and productive for developers of all levels.
Understanding Replit AI Power-Ups
Replit AI Power-Ups utilize artificial intelligence to assist with code generation, debugging, and testing. They are designed to streamline workflows by providing intelligent suggestions and automating routine tasks, enabling developers to focus on more complex problem-solving.
Practical Tips for Maximizing Code Automation
- Leverage AI Code Suggestions: Use Power-Ups to get real-time code completions and suggestions, reducing typing time and minimizing errors.
- Automate Repetitive Tasks: Set up scripts and templates that can be triggered automatically, saving time on boilerplate code.
- Integrate with Version Control: Use AI tools to assist with commit messages and code reviews, ensuring consistency and quality.
Enhancing Testing with AI Power-Ups
Effective testing is crucial for reliable software. Replit AI Power-Ups can help automate test case generation and debugging, leading to faster development cycles and more robust applications.
Automated Test Generation
Use AI to generate comprehensive test cases based on your code. This ensures edge cases are covered and reduces the manual effort involved in writing tests.
Smart Debugging Assistance
AI-powered debugging tools can analyze error messages and suggest potential fixes. This accelerates troubleshooting and helps maintain code quality.
Best Practices for Using Replit AI Power-Ups
- Start Small: Begin with simple automation tasks to familiarize yourself with AI capabilities.
- Review AI Suggestions: Always verify generated code or test cases to ensure accuracy and security.
- Combine with Manual Testing: Use AI tools as an aid, not a complete replacement for manual review.
- Stay Updated: Keep abreast of new Power-Ups and updates to maximize their benefits.
Conclusion
Replit AI Power-Ups offer a significant boost to coding productivity by automating routine tasks and enhancing testing processes. By understanding and applying these practical tips, developers can unlock the full potential of AI-assisted development, leading to faster, more reliable software creation.